/*For pagination*/

.pagination {
	display: inline-block;
	padding-left: 0;
	margin: 20px 0;
	border-radius: 0;
}

.pagination>li {
	display: inline;
}

.pagination>li>a,
.pagination>li>span {
	position: relative;
	float: left;
	padding: 6px 15px 6px 9px;
	line-height: 1.42857143;
	text-decoration: none;
	color: #1e53a5;
	background-color: #ffffff;
	border: none!important;
	margin-left: -1px;
}

.product-list-right-component .pagination-bar .pagination-bar-results {
	color: #454545;
	font-weight: 600;
}

.pagination-bar .pagination-bar-results {
	margin-top: 0px;
	padding: 0;
	/*padding: 0 20px;*/
	color: #929292;
	margin-left: -152px;
	float: right;
}

.pagination-wrap {
	float: right;
	text-align: initial;
}

.account-section-content .account-orderhistory-pagination .top .pagination-wrap .pagination-bar-results {
	color: #454545;
	margin-top: -78px;
}

.account-orderhistory-pagination.bottomcart .pagination-wrap .pagination-bar-results {
	display: none;
}

.pagination {
	border: none!important;
	font-weight: 600;
	margin: 5px 0 0;
	/* width: 162px; */
	height: 25px;
	float: right;
	clear: both;
	margin-top: 5px !important;
}

.pagination>.active>a,
.pagination>.active>span,
.pagination>.active>a:hover,
.pagination>.active>span:hover,
.pagination>.active>a:focus,
.pagination>.active>span:focus {
	z-index: 3;
	cursor: default;
	background-color: #1e53a5!important;
	width: 20px;
	height: 31px;
	border-radius: 2px;
	color: #fff;
}

.pagination>li.pagination-prev>a,
.pagination>li.pagination-prev>span {
	margin-right: 15px;
	width: 0px;
	border-bottom-left-radius: 0;
	border-top-left-radius: 0;
}

.account-section .pagination-bar .pagination-bar-results {
	font-size: 13px;
	font-weight: 600;
	border: none;
}

.pagination>li:last-child>a,
.pagination>li:last-child>span {
	border-bottom-right-radius: 0;
	border-top-right-radius: 0;
	margin-left: 0px;
}

.pagination>li>a:hover,
.pagination>li>span:hover,
.pagination>li>a:focus,
.pagination>li>span:focus {
	z-index: 2;
	color: #a6a6a6;
	background-color: transparent;
	border-color: #dddddd;
}


/**** 1042 changes ****/

.pagination>.disabled>span,
.pagination>.disabled>span:hover,
.pagination>.disabled>span:focus,
.pagination>.disabled>a,
.pagination>.disabled>a:hover,
.pagination>.disabled>a:focus {
	color: #a6a6a6;
	background-color: #ffffff;
	border-color: #dddddd;
	cursor: not-allowed;
}

.pagination-lg>li>a,
.pagination-lg>li>span {
	padding: 10px 15px;
	font-size: 18px;
	line-height: 1.3333333;
}

.pagination-lg>li:first-child>a,
.pagination-lg>li:first-child>span {
	border-bottom-left-radius: 0;
	border-top-left-radius: 0;
}

.pagination-lg>li:last-child>a,
.pagination-lg>li:last-child>span {
	border-bottom-right-radius: 0;
	border-top-right-radius: 0;
}

.pagination-sm>li>a,
.pagination-sm>li>span {
	padding: 5px 10px;
	font-size: 13px;
	line-height: 1.5;
}

.pagination-sm>li:first-child>a,
.pagination-sm>li:first-child>span {
	border-bottom-left-radius: 0;
	border-top-left-radius: 0;
}

.pagination-sm>li:last-child>a,
.pagination-sm>li:last-child>span {
	border-bottom-right-radius: 0;
	border-top-right-radius: 0;
}

.account-orderhistory-pagination .sort-refine-bar .form-group select {
	text-transform: initial;
	height: 34px;
	border-radius: 3px;
	border: solid 1px #dddddd;
	background-color: #f7f7f7;
	margin-bottom: 20px;
	/* padding: 5px 35px 5px 5px; */
	/*  removed as was showing issue in IE */
	font-size: 14px;
	border: 1px solid #ccc;
	-webkit-appearance: none;
	-moz-appearance: none;
	appearance: none;
	line-height: normal;
	/* background: url(/_ui/responsive/theme-tci/images/down-arrow.svg) 96% / 10% no-repeat #fff;*/
}

.account-orderhistory-pagination .sort-refine-bar .sortForm1 {
	position: relative;
}


/* .account-orderhistory-pagination .sort-refine-bar .sortForm2 { position:relative;width:38%} */

.sort-refine-bar .sortForm1 {
	position: relative;
	width: 42%
}

.sort-refine-bar .sortForm2 {
	position: relative;
	width: 42%
}

.sort-refine-bar .form-group select {
	width: 100%;
	height: 38px;
	padding-left: 10px;
	border: 1px solid #ccc;
	border-radius: 3px;
	-webkit-appearance: none;
	-moz-appearance: none;
	appearance: none;
	-o-appearance: none;
}

.account-orderhistory-pagination .sort-refine-bar .orderHistory select.form-control {
	height: 42px;
}

.sort-refine-bar .form-group select.sortOptions1 {
	background-color: transparent
}

.sort-refine-bar .form-group select::-ms-expand {
	display: none;
}

.account-orderhistory-pagination .sort-refine-bar .sortForm1 {
	position: relative;
	width: 31%
}

.account-orderhistory-pagination .sort-refine-bar .sortForm2 {
	position: relative;
	width: auto
}

.sort-refine-bar .sortForm1 {
	position: relative;
	width: 58%
}

.sort-refine-bar .sortForm2 {
	position: relative;
	width: 58%
}

.account-orderhistory-pagination .sort-refine-bar .sortForm1 {
	position: relative;
	width: 100%;
	;
}


/* .account-orderhistory-pagination .sort-refine-bar .sortForm2 { position:relative;width:135px;} */

.sort-refine-bar .sortForm1 {
	position: relative;
	width: auto
}

.sort-refine-bar .sortForm2 {
	position: relative;
	width: auto
}

.product-list-right-component .sort-refine-bar .sortForm1 {
	position: relative;
	width: 100%
}

.product-list-right-component .sort-refine-bar .sortForm2 {
	position: relative;
	width: 100%
}

.pagination-bar .pagination-toolbar {
	padding-left: 0
}

.account-orderhistory-pagination .pagination-wrap {
	float: none;
	margin-left: 191px;
}

.account-orderhistory-pagination .pagination {
	border: none!important;
	font-weight: 600;
	margin: 0px 0 15px 20px;
	width: auto;
	height: auto;
	padding: 32px 0 0
}

.pagination-bar.bottom .orderHistoryCount {
	display: none!important
}

.pagination-bar.top .orderHistoryCount {
	float: left
}

.pagination>li.pagination-next>a,
.pagination>li.pagination-next>span {
	width: auto;
}

.pagination-bar,
.product__list--wrapper {
	margin: 0
}


/****Responsive ****/


/* @media (min-width: 1024px){ 
	.page-saved-carts .saved-cart-pagination .pagination-bar-results {
	   	position: relative;
    	top: -124px;
   		float: left;
	}
	.page-saved-carts .saved-cart-pagination .pagination-bar-results {
	    position: relative;
   		
	}
} */

.saved-cart-pagination .pagination {
	margin-right: 0px;
	margin-bottom: 20px;
}

@media (max-width: 1023px) {
	.account-orderhistory-pagination .sort-refine-bar .form-group select {
		width: 100%;
	}
	.account-orderhistory-pagination .sort-refine-bar .sortForm1 {
		position: relative;
		width: 100%;
	}
	.account-orderhistory-pagination .sort-refine-bar .sortForm2 {
		position: relative;
		width: 100%;
	}
	.pagination-bar .pagination-bar-results {
		float: none;
		margin-left: 0px;
	}
	.product-list-right-component .pagination-bar .pagination-bar-results {
		top: 10px;
		position: relative;
		/* left: 5px;*/
	}
	.saved-cart-pagination .pagination {
		margin-right: 0;
		margin-bottom:0
	}
}